The Donlin Gold pipeline project advances with the award of the engineering contract to Worley Alaska, which will be responsible for the technical design and feasibility study of the key energy system for this mining project in Alaska.
A Key Contract for Energy Supply
Worley Alaska has been selected by NOVAGOLD Resources Inc. and Donlin Gold Holdings to carry out the bankable feasibility study and preliminary engineering design for the natural gas pipeline. This infrastructure will enable the supply of power to the Donlin Gold project, one of the most ambitious gold developments in the United States.
Furthermore, the contract includes comprehensive system planning, from pipeline routing to the integration of disciplines such as civil engineering, environmental, and regulatory permitting.
The Donlin Gold Pipeline Will Be 508 Kilometers Long with Arctic Design
The project includes the construction of an underground pipeline approximately 508 kilometers long that will connect Cook Inlet to the power generation plant at the deposit.
Additionally, the design must adapt to complex geographical conditions, traversing mountainous areas and remote regions. This demands specific solutions for arctic and subarctic environments, as well as advanced constructability strategies.
Likewise, the system will incorporate technologies for gas handling and control, ensuring a stable energy supply for future mining operations.
Donlin Gold, a Strategic Project in Gold Mining
The Donlin Gold project is located in the Kuskokwim gold belt and is positioned as one of the largest gold mines in the country. It is currently in the bankable feasibility study phase, with completion scheduled for 2027.
According to technical estimates, the deposit could produce over one million ounces of gold per year during a mine life of nearly three decades, reinforcing the need for robust energy infrastructure.
Technical Expertise in Remote Environments
Worley brings over 60 years of experience in Alaska, with capabilities in engineering, procurement, logistics, and construction. This track record is crucial for executing complex projects in hard-to-access locations.
In this context, the company will combine its regional knowledge with its global reach to ensure the efficient development of the pipeline, considered a fundamental piece for the project’s operational viability.
